Purbarun Dhar is a scholar working on Biomedical Engineering, Mechanical Engineering and Materials Chemistry. According to data from OpenAlex, Purbarun Dhar has authored 59 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Biomedical Engineering, 20 papers in Mechanical Engineering and 18 papers in Materials Chemistry. Recurrent topics in Purbarun Dhar’s work include Heat Transfer and Optimization (14 papers), Nanofluid Flow and Heat Transfer (14 papers) and Heat Transfer and Boiling Studies (8 papers). Purbarun Dhar is often cited by papers focused on Heat Transfer and Optimization (14 papers), Nanofluid Flow and Heat Transfer (14 papers) and Heat Transfer and Boiling Studies (8 papers). Purbarun Dhar collaborates with scholars based in India, United States and Saudi Arabia. Purbarun Dhar's co-authors include Sarit K. Das, Sanjeev Jain, Ajay Katiyar, A. R. Harikrishnan, Tandra Nandi, Sateesh Gedupudi, S.C. Kaushik, Prabhat K. Agnihotri, Arvind Pattamatta and Ritunesh Kumar and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and The Journal of Physical Chemistry B.
